Gochugaru Baked Tofu, Melon, Pepper Veggie skewers with Chili Lime Sauce
Description
The Gochugaru Baked Tofu, Melon, and Pepper Veggie Skewers bring together the spicy, smoky flavor of gochugaru-seasoned tofu with fresh melon and green pepper pieces grilled to tender and slightly charred perfection. Firm tofu is pressed and marinated in a soy sauce-based mix seasoned with garlic powder and gochugaru, ensuring the pepper flakes coat the tofu evenly before grilling.
The skewers are cooked on a grill or skillet grill until the tofu develops grill marks on at least two sides, while the melon and pepper pieces get a light sprinkle of gochugaru and salt enhancing their natural sweetness and crunch. The accompanying sweet chili lime sauce combines rice vinegar, lime juice, maple syrup, gochugaru, and garlic powder to balance heat, sweetness, and acidity as a dipping complement.
These skewers can be served on their own as a spicy appetizer or arranged over salad greens for a light meal component. They balance savory, spicy, fresh, and sweet elements in one dish.
The tofu absorbs the gochugaru marinade well after chilling for 30 minutes, improving flavor. Use extra firm tofu for best texture and maintain even cubing for stable skewers that hold up during grilling.
Ingredients
- 14 oz firm tofu pressed for 10 minutes, then cubed into large cubes, or extra firm tofu
- 1 green pepper or other veggies
- 2 lices of melon of choice
- 1 tbsp soy sauce
- 1/2 tsp garlic powder
- 2 to 3 tsp gochugaru pepper flakes or use other pepper flakes
- salt a good dash
- gochugaru for the sprinkling
- salt for the sprinkling
Sweet Chili Lime dipping Sauce:
- 2 tbsp rice vinegar
- 1 tbsp lime juice
- 2 tbsp maple syrup or more
- 1/2 tsp gochugaru pepper flakes or red pepper flakes
- 1/4 tsp garlic powder , add a clove of garlic minced as well for more flavor
- salt a good pinch
Instructions
- Cube the tofu and veggies into large pieces so that they dont fall off the skewers easily. Mix soy sauce, garlic, pepper flakes and salt in a bowl. Brush the mixture liberally on the tofu cubes and let chill to marinate for half an hour. Brush so that the pepper flakes are spread over all cubes. You can also sprinkle more gochugaru as needed.
- Then Skewer the tofu cubes, melon and peppers onto skewers. Sprinkle more gochugaru/pepper and salt on the melons and peppers.
- Grill on a grill skillet or grill, until tofu has nice grill marks. Turn the skewers around to have grill marks or on atleast 2 sides of the tofu. Serve as is or over salad, with sweet chili sauce.
Notes
- Nutrition information provided applies to one serving of the skewers with the dipping sauce.
- Press tofu for at least 10 minutes to remove excess moisture, ensuring better grilling texture.
- Marinate tofu with gochugaru and spices for 30 minutes to allow the flavors to penetrate well before grilling.
